Description
Lake View is a popular accommodation in Wanaka, New Zealand, offering a variety of rooms and studios with stunning views of Lake Wanaka and the surrounding mountains.
[See more][See less]
Capacity: 2
Number of rooms: 1rooms
Star Rating: 4 stars
Room features: Non-smoking rooms